impedimented

adj

Etymology

From impediment + -ed.

  1. derived from impedimentum
  2. inherited from impediment
  3. suffixed as impedimented — “impediment + ed

Definitions

  1. impeded

    impeded; afflicted with an impediment

    • His speech slow, and somewhat impedimented; rather, as I conceive, by custom, and a long imitation of some that did first instruct him, than by any defect in nature, as appeared by much amendment of the same […]
